Project Activities
The CGCS is conducting three rounds of Fellowship competitions, and making three Fellowship awards in each round, for a total of nine research projects. Senior Fellow awards include a $100,000 stipend and additional financial support. Projects are intended to last 18 to 24 months. District commitment must include not only a letter of support, but also a dedicated point person with decision-making authority and a working committee of key participants-all with release time to collaborate with the Senior Research Fellow.
